Overview
The OPA2192IDR is a high-performance operational amplifier manufactured by Texas Instruments. It belongs to the family of precision op-amps designed for applications requiring both DC accuracy and AC performance. The device is particularly noted for its low input offset voltage and low noise characteristics, making it suitable for precision analog circuits. Packaged in an 8-pin SOIC format, the OPA2192IDR operates over a wide supply voltage range and features rail-to-rail output swing. These attributes, combined with its low quiescent current, make it ideal for battery-powered and portable applications where power efficiency is crucial.
Structure and Working Principle
The OPA2192IDR incorporates a classic three-stage op-amp architecture: input differential stage, gain stage, and output stage. The input stage uses precision-matched transistors to minimize offset voltage and drift. The gain stage provides high open-loop gain, while the output stage delivers rail-to-rail swing capability. The device operates on the fundamental principle of differential amplification, where the voltage difference between its two inputs is amplified by a very high factor (typically >120 dB). Internal compensation ensures stability across various operating conditions. The op-amp can be configured in numerous circuit topologies (inverting, non-inverting, differential, etc.) depending on application requirements.
Key Features
The OPA2192IDR stands out for its exceptional combination of precision and power efficiency. It features an ultra-low input offset voltage of 25µV (maximum) and very low drift of 0.5µV/°C, ensuring accurate signal processing over temperature variations. The device also exhibits low noise density of 5.5nV/√Hz at 1kHz, critical for sensitive measurement applications. Power consumption is remarkably low at 1mA per amplifier, enabling use in power-sensitive designs. The wide supply range of ±2.25V to ±18V (or 4.5V to 36V single supply) provides design flexibility. Additional features include EMI-hardened inputs and unity-gain stable operation.
Application Areas
The OPA2192IDR finds extensive use in industrial automation systems, particularly in sensor signal conditioning circuits for temperature, pressure, and position sensors. Its precision characteristics make it suitable for medical instrumentation such as patient monitoring equipment and portable diagnostic devices. In the automotive sector, the op-amp is employed in battery management systems, current sensing circuits, and various control modules. Test and measurement equipment manufacturers utilize it in high-accuracy data acquisition systems. The device is also common in scientific instrumentation and high-end audio applications where signal fidelity is paramount.
Maintenance and Precautions
While integrated circuits like the OPA2192IDR generally require minimal maintenance, proper handling is essential for optimal performance. ESD precautions should always be observed during installation and handling. The device should be stored in antistatic packaging when not in use. PCB layout considerations include keeping input traces short, using ground planes, and proper decoupling (typically 0.1µF ceramic capacitor near supply pins). For best noise performance, avoid routing high-frequency signals near amplifier inputs. The device is rated for industrial temperature range (-40°C to +125°C), but thermal management may be necessary in high-density designs.
B2B Procurement Guide
When procuring OPA2192IDR in quantity, verify the supply chain thoroughly to avoid counterfeit components. Authorized distributors like Arrow, Avnet, or Texas Instruments' direct sales channels are recommended. Consider lead times, especially for industrial-grade components which may have longer procurement cycles. For high-volume purchases (typically >1,000 units), negotiate pricing based on annual demand forecasts. Some distributors offer value-added services like programming, testing, or kitting. Ensure purchased devices meet the required temperature grade (industrial or automotive) for your application. Always request manufacturer's certificate of conformity for critical applications.
